Report: Occurrence of specialized app attacks quickly rising

In the past year, the number of specialized attacks, which target specific applications through means such as making malicious changes to the code, has sharply risen. According to Digital.ai’s 2024 Application Security Threat Report, the likelihood of an iOS app having maliciously modified code grew from 6% to 20% in the last year. ITOps Times Open-Source Project of the Week: Vineyard

Vineyard is an in-memory data manager designed specifically for data-heavy analytics.  It uses shared memory to efficiently share data across different systems without needing to do serialization and deserialization.
